For example, in Figure 1-2, an AN router sends BOOTP requests for its IP
address. The upstream router receives the request on PVC 31. The
upstream router determines the DLCI, refers to DLCI 31 in the BOOTP
client interface table, finds the IP address, and sends a BOOTP response
containing the IP address back to PVC 31.

5. The upstream router sends the IP address and subnet mask to the AN in
a BOOTP response message.
Note: The BOOTP client interface table contains a data link connection
identifier (DLCI) and IP address pair for each PVC. You use Site Manager to
create this table when you follow the instructions for setting up routing paths
